Exterior Bulbs on the 2016 Toyota Vitz Yaris: Purpose and Maintenance Tips
The 2016 Toyota Vitz Yaris, known for its reliability and efficiency, comes equipped with a range of exterior bulbs designed to keep the vehicle safe and roadworthy. Exterior bulbs are an essential part of any vehicle's lighting system, serving a variety of functions from making the car visible to others, to signalling intentions on the road clearly and effectively. When it comes to the Vitz Yaris, these bulbs are no different - they play a crucial role in daily driving safety and convenience.
Exterior bulbs on this model include headlights, daytime running lights, turn signal indicators, brake lights, reverse lights, and side marker lights. Each one has a specific purpose that contributes to the overall safety and operation of the vehicle.
Headlights are perhaps the most important exterior bulbs on any car. On the 2016 Vitz Yaris, they provide illumination of the road ahead during night driving or poor visibility conditions, helping the driver see obstacles, road signs, and lane markings clearly. They also make the vehicle visible to other drivers and pedestrians, reducing the risk of accidents. The vehicle typically uses halogen bulbs for headlights, though some variants may be fitted with LED options depending on the trim level or region.
Daytime running lights, usually LED or low-powered bulbs, increase the vehicle's visibility during daylight hours. This helps other drivers spot the car sooner, which is especially useful in busy cities or on busy highways. Turn signals on the front, rear, and sometimes side of the car communicate the driver's intention to make a turn or change lanes, enhancing road safety by alerting other road users in advance.
Brake lights and reverse lights, positioned at the rear of the Vitz Yaris, serve critical safety functions. Brake lights illuminate brighter than regular tail lights when the driver depresses the brake pedal, warning following vehicles to slow down. Reverse lights come on automatically when the car is put into reverse gear, signalling that the vehicle is about to move backwards. These exterior bulbs are vital for safe driving in parking lots, narrow streets, or busy traffic conditions.
Side marker lights or position lights may also be fitted, especially in certain trim levels or markets. These small bulbs improve the visibility of the car's sides at night or in poor weather, giving other motorists a better sense of the vehicle's size and position.
Replacing or maintaining exterior bulbs on the 2016 Toyota Vitz Yaris is a straightforward but important part of regular vehicle servicing. With time and use, bulbs can dim or burn out completely, which not only reduces visibility but also compromises safety and can lead to fines or failed vehicle inspections.
When it comes to replacement, it is recommended to use manufacturer-approved bulbs or exact equivalents to ensure compatibility and performance. For example, halogen bulbs for the headlights and standard incandescent or LED bulbs for other applications should be sourced carefully. It is also important to replace bulbs in pairs where applicable to maintain even lighting and prevent sudden failures on one side.
Maintaining the exterior bulbs involves not just changing the bulbs themselves, but also checking and cleaning the surrounding light housings and lens covers. Dirt, moisture, or damage to these components can reduce the effectiveness of the lighting system. Regularly inspect the exterior lights for cracks, foggy lenses, or water ingress, and replace damaged parts promptly to avoid corrosion or electrical problems.
Also, when replacing bulbs, it is a good idea to wear gloves or use a clean cloth to handle the new bulb. Oils and dirt from bare fingers can damage halogen bulbs or reduce their lifespan. Ensuring all bulbs are seated securely and connectors are properly attached will prevent flickering or intermittent operation that can be frustrating and unsafe.
During routine servicing or before long trips, drivers should take some time to walk around the car and test each exterior bulb. Ask a friend to help by pressing the brake pedal or activating turn signals while you check all lights are working. This simple check can save a lot of headaches on the road.
